How do I enable tap on Mac?
The best way for most users to enable touch tapping on their Mac is through System Preferences:
- Go to the Apple menu and open “System Preferences”
- Choose “Trackpad” and go to the “Point & Click” tab.
- Check the box next to ‘Tap to click’

Can you tap on an Apple mouse?
The Magic Mouse supports tapping or double tapping with one finger and tapping or double tapping with two fingers, all of which trigger different actions, depending on what you have enabled. The Magic Mouse also supports swiping gestures with one or two fingers.

What is tap to click?
“Tapping” or “tap-to-click” is the name given to the behavior where a short finger touch down/up sequence maps into a button click. This is most commonly used on touchpads, but may be available on other devices.
Does MacBook touchpad click?
The Force Touch trackpad lets you Force click by pressing on the trackpad and then applying more pressure. This allows you to take advantage of added functionality in many apps and system features on your Mac. To see a video of a Force click, choose Apple menu > System Preferences.

Can you use a trackpad and mouse at the same time?
Yes, you can use Magic Mouse and Magic Trackpad at the same time! Both devices establish contact with the Apple computer via Bluetooth and are no obstacles to each other.
Can you use a Mac without a mouse?
You can use your keyboard like a mouse to navigate and interact with items onscreen. Use the Tab key and arrow keys to navigate, then press Space bar to select an item. Choose Apple menu > System Preferences, then click Keyboard.

What are the shortcut keys for Mac?
Cut, copy, paste, and other common shortcuts
- Command-X: Cut the selected item and copy it to the Clipboard.
- Command-C: Copy the selected item to the Clipboard. …
- Command-V: Paste the contents of the Clipboard into the current document or app. …
- Command-Z: Undo the previous command. …
- Command-A: Select All items.

Does the MacBook Pro touchpad click?
Your Force Touch trackpad doesn’t click when it’s turned off, because it needs power to provide haptic feedback (like clicks). This applies to Magic Trackpad as well as Force Touch trackpads built into Mac notebook computers.
How do you enable tap on iPad?
How to enable taps and clicks on the iPad Pro Magic Keyboard
- Open up the Settings app.
- Choose General > Trackpad.
- Then enable Tap to Click and Two Finger Secondary Click.

How do I shutdown my Mac without a mouse?
Control–Option–Command–Power button* or Control–Option–Command–Media Eject : Quit all apps, then shut down your Mac.
